The national park was declared in 1997 as the
first of its kind in all of Hungary. Popular programmes are the legendary Blue Tour, a hiking event with a 120 years tradition, or the Wine Route of Koszeg that gives an
understanding of the producing of the
country's unique wines, also typical specialties like honey cakes, goat cheese
and apple products. Eco-friendly practices in
agriculture, construction and forestry have been at the forefront of
local municipalities for years, also measures
to renovate the springs in environmentally friendly manners have been
implemented with help coming from volunteers. There are also yearly
cleaning movements that rid the park of waste deposits and other
undesirables. Winner of the "2009 Tourism and protected area award" as a European Destination of Excellence (EDEN).
